Saudi Arabia announced, Saturday, five deaths from the coronavirus (COVID-19), bringing the total number to 92.

According to Health authorities, infections hit 8,274 with 1,132 new cases.

Recoveries in Saudi Arabia are at 1,329 after 280 individuals overcome the disease.

In the Kingdom, there are 78 cases under intensive care.

Qatar declares 8th fatality from coronavirus

Qatar on Saturday declared the eighth death due to the novel coronavirus (COVID-19) in addition to registering 345 new confirmed infection cases.

Qatari Ministry of Health said in a statement the single fatality was of a Qatari, aged 59, who had suffered a cardiac arrest.

Total number of contamination cases climed to 5,008, mostly of expatriate workers who had been quarantined.

A small proportion of the cases belonged to citizens and residents, who had mingled within families or at work.

The new cases were placed in total quarantine and given necessary medical treatment, the ministry statement said, adding that there were 46 new registered recoveries, with the total of such cases amounting to 510.
